About This Item

Maplewood, NJ: C. S. Hammond & Company, 1959. First Edition. In pictorial stapled wraps with 48 pages of illustrations and facts of the world. Tight and intact binding. Clean and unmarked pages. Light rubbing to edge of spine. Photos upon request. . Soft Cover. Very Good. 4to - over 9¾" - 12" tall.

Glossary

Some terminology that may be used in this description includes:

Tight
Used to mean that the binding of a book has not been overly loosened by frequent use.
First Edition

Rubbing
Abrasion or wear to the surface. Usually used in reference to a book's boards or dust-jacket.
